Output b86c99ee631882329f9f5c1bd927d40735efa676673c6b77371cf0bc0c22b2e1:1

value
303956828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662c7e9989a1eb290fea54c6b05c8babd036cbc3 OP_EQUAL
address
MHDQTXkihXQyK2Kpt2PCZNLWAZ6TWNhSQ3
transaction
b86c99ee631882329f9f5c1bd927d40735efa676673c6b77371cf0bc0c22b2e1
spent
true